Output 89fa9305c336d618404f65cc357eac72a01e336ec1724fa00ba5dc595eb8a1d3:0

value
1112537
script pubkey
OP_0 OP_PUSHBYTES_20 91ed4776e983ad39ec27d6e9d9689f7521bb446b
address
bc1qj8k5wahfswknnmp86m5aj6ylw5smk3rthjmqjh
transaction
89fa9305c336d618404f65cc357eac72a01e336ec1724fa00ba5dc595eb8a1d3
confirmations
188954
spent
true